Introduction

Mistersynthesizer’s weight-loss journey on Reddit is a testament to the power of determination and hard work. He lost 32lbs in just four months, going from 205lbs to 173lbs. Through strong will, a healthy diet, and exercise, he was able to achieve his desired goal.

Diet Plan

Mistersynthesizer limited himself to 1600-1700 net calories per day, which meant that he consumed about 1900 calories a day most days. He did enough walking to bring his net down, making it easier to get down to his desired caloric intake without starving. Consuming high protein and fat diets also helped him a lot, but he didn't need to go full keto. He consumed 100-150 grams of carbs per day on average, which helped balance his intake and maintain a healthy diet.

Exercise Plan

Mistersynthesizer followed the StrongLifts program and continued walking whenever he got the chance. He incorporated weight training to build muscle while keeping his body fat low. Nothing fancy, just a simple and effective workout routine that fit his lifestyle.

Results

Mistersynthesizer lost an average of 2 pounds every week for four months, a tremendous accomplishment. He cut his alcohol consumption by 80-90% and made small but consistent changes to his diet and exercise regimen that, over time, had a significant impact. Besides the weight loss, he also looks younger and healthier, with more confidence and more attention from the ladies- a perfect example of the numerous benefits of a healthy lifestyle.
